Venus transit of Sun
Lens: Tamron 28-300 Ultrazoom XR Camera: Pentax K-5 Photo Location: Ajax, Ontario ISO: 800 Shutter Speed: 1/350s Aperture: F8 
Posted By: mtansley, 06-05-2012, 06:09 PM

Not a very good photo but it does show Venus against the sun. I'm happy.

This was using my cheap 2x teleconverter and I rigged up a solar filter using filters from an old Davis marine artificial horizon taped to an old filter ring.

Amazing how small the sun actually is when you see it through a filter.
